Fiat-Trattori 88

Differential fluid capacity & service interval

Fiat-Trattori 88 differential fluid capacity ranges from 5,9 to 8,5 liters. Service intervals include a 400 hour check and a 1600 hour change. The data covers 4 configurations.

TypeSpecifications
  • 60-88, 60-88 DT (1991-1993)
  • Front
  • Use: Normal
  • Capacity 5,9 liter
  • Check 400 hours
  • Change 1600 hours
  • Code: (4x4)
  • 65-88, 65-88 DT (1991-1993)
  • Front
  • Use: Normal
  • Capacity 5,9 liter
  • Check 400 hours
  • Change 1600 hours
  • Code: (4x4)
  • 70-88, 70-88 DT (1991-1993)
  • Front
  • Use: Normal
  • Capacity 8,5 liter
  • Check 400 hours
  • Change 1600 hours
  • Code: (4x4)
  • 80-88, 80-88 DT (1991-1993)
  • Front
  • Use: Normal
  • Capacity 8,5 liter
  • Check 400 hours
  • Change 1600 hours
  • Code: (4x4)
